Jamie Hobbs, founder of luxury outdoor furniture company Indian Ocean, is stepping down after 33 years as Managing Director.
David Mahony has been appointed Commercial Director and will be managing all commercial and operational aspects of the business.
David has a background in fashion having held senior positions at Moncler, Burberry and Prada and brings strong organisational, leadership and business management skills as well as a passionate belief in team building to drive company performance.
Regarding his successor, Jamie Hobbs said: “David has significant experience in managing and running businesses in the luxury sector and we are fortunate to have recruited him to Indian Ocean”.

The transition will allow more time for Hobbs to focus on furniture design as well as longer term strategy. “I want to do more of what I love, which is creating beautiful, well-designed furniture to help our clients enjoy their time spent relaxing outdoors.”
Indian Ocean has led the way in changing how we use our outdoor space and is now just as recognised for the luxury cutting-edge contemporary pieces as well as for their classic Teak heritage.
Established in 1990 and with two London stores, the company are also celebrating 10 years in Harrods as the leading outdoor furniture brand.
